zvtvz / zvt

modular quant framework.

Home Page:https://zvt.readthedocs.io/en/latest/

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

下载了历史数据替换后,更新数据报错

epoches opened this issue · comments

from zvt.domain import *
from tests.context import init_test_context
init_test_context()
def getdata():
Stock.record_data(provider='joinquant')
在测试目录添加文件,提示:
JoinquantIndexMoneyFlowRecorder:IndexMoneyFlow
{'password': '', 'token': 'error: mob/pwd不能为空', 'username': ''}
目录放到zvt samples下面就好了。
建议给个例子,不然新手不知道怎么更新。
还有技术指标,没看到具体的指标说明。这里面注释太少了,不是每个人都有时间研究源码的。大多数是对不感兴趣的会用就行。
例如怎么使用聚宽 jqdatasdk和zvt共用。
包括providers有具体有哪些,如何能最快的更新到最新。
我用Stock1dHfqKdata.record_data(provider = 'joinquant', sleeping_time = 1) 速度会快些,用jqdatasdk是否有更快的方法。
这些很影响改策略的速度,只有有人用才会有人开发啊,用的人是基石。

@epoches 更新了部分文档,建议step by step走一遍。

commented

哪里有step by step?
zvt\ui\apps\factor_app.py#L16

from zvt.domain import TraderInfo 这个报找不到 ,改成

from zvt.trader.trader_schemas import AccountStats, Order, TraderInfo, Position

master 跑起来了,tader_info 是空的。

@hxsam 可以跟着英文文档走一遍。由于不少功能还在快速开发中,无法保证兼容性。